Apple Sues OpenAI, Accusing It of Stealing Company Secrets

Apple has filed a lawsuit against OpenAI and former employees, alleging the theft of trade secrets and intellectual property.

The story so far

Apple is suing OpenAI and previous employees, including a former VP of product design and engineer Chang Liu, for the theft of trade secrets. The legal action follows the integration of ChatGPT into Apple's ecosystem and focuses on mass IP theft.

Coverage from Forbes, Axios, and Yahoo Finance highlights the trade secret allegations, while The Times of India notes a 40-page lawsuit detailing items Liu allegedly took upon leaving. Business Insider reports that the lawsuit also critiques OpenAI's recruiting practices, and NDTV mentions a specific "LOL" moment involving an engineer that triggered the dispute.

The focus now shifts to the specifics of the IP theft and the implications of the recruitment practices scrutinized in the lawsuit.

The obvious questions

Who is being sued alongside OpenAI?

The lawsuit targets OpenAI as well as two former employees, including a previous VP of product design and former iPhone engineer Chang Liu.

What are the primary allegations in the lawsuit?

Apple accuses OpenAI of trade secret theft and mass IP theft, while also criticizing the company's recruiting practices.

What prompted the legal action according to some reports?

NDTV reports that a "LOL" moment involving an OpenAI engineer triggered the legal fight.
